In *Monster Hunter Wilds*, trapping monsters is crucial for gathering all the necessary parts for armor forging. To master this skill, you'll need Trap Tools. Here's a comprehensive guide on how to obtain and use them effectively.
While *Monster Hunter Wilds* might not give you a tutorial on trapping monsters or acquiring Trap Tools, the process will be familiar if you've played previous games in the series.
To get Trap Tools, head to the Provisions Stockpiler NPC at your Base Camp. Engage in conversation with him and browse through his inventory until you find the Trap Tools, which are priced at 200 Zenny each. It's a smart move to stock up on several, especially if you're aiming to farm specific monsters or capture every monster in the game.
Keep in mind that the only way to acquire Trap Tools is through purchase at the Base Camp; they can't be found out in the wild like other resources.
Once you've secured your Trap Tools, it's time to learn how to use them effectively. You can combine a Trap Tool with a Net (using Spiderweb or Ivy) to create a Pitfall Trap, or with a Thunderbug Capacitor to craft a Shock Trap.
Both types of traps are effective, but be aware that certain monsters have resistances. For example, Shock Traps won't affect Rey Dau, the lightning dragon, so you'll need to opt for a Pitfall Trap instead.
Remember, you can only carry one Trap item at a time, so timing is key. Use your traps when the monster is weakened to maximize your chances of success.
